KENTON THEATRE - HERITAGE OPEN DAY 

10.00am,12.00 & 2.00pm

The Kenton Theatre is pleased to be participating again in this year’s Heritage Open Day organised by English Heritage. Join us for tours of the auditorium, back stage and fly tower. Listen to a talk on the history of the theatre which is now over 200 years old and is the fourth oldest working theatre in the country. Your guide will explain the workings of the theatre and how the ghost occasionally interferes!

Free entry—No need to book—Refreshments available
